			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>NY, NY (PRWEB) April 25, 2012 </p>
<p> Capital Access Network, Inc.s (CAN) Data Services Division today released its Q1 2012 Small Business Credit Sales Report (SBCS Report).  The SBCS Report shows that consumers chose to use their available credit at restaurants, which continue to show significant positive year-over-year (YoY) card sales.  Q1 2012 marks the sixth consecutive quarter of positive YoY restaurant card sales, recording a 4.4 percent rise. This is the highest YoY increase in this category since the report began tracking sales in Q1 2007. </p>
<p>&#13;</p>
<p>Small businesses began 2012 with a Q1 YoY card sales decline for the eighteenth straight quarter.  However, the rate of decline decreased for the third straight quarter, and at 0.7 percent was the lowest reported decline since Q1 2008.  According to The Federal Reserves April, 2012 G 19 Release, consumer revolving credit availability decreased on a month-over-month basis in January 2012 (-4.4 percent), and is projected to have increased slightly in February 2012 to -3.3 percent.  In contrast, Main Street YoY card sales declined only 0.6 percent in January 2012, and increased 1.62 percent in February 2012.  </p>
<p>&#13;</p>
<p>We see several notable increases in this report.  But most impressive is the sustained improvement that has occurred in restaurant card sales.  Consumers increased their use of credit cards on dining compared to this time last year. And, the trend has continued for a few quarters, with an unprecedented leap during first quarter of this year to a level not seen since we began tracking for the report. Even though it appears that consumer credit is down, available dollars are being spent dining,&#8221; stated Glenn Goldman, CAN&#8217;s CEO and President. Restaurants with smaller average ticket sizes benefited the most, but it appears that Valentines Day may have stimulated card sales of the category.  And while non-restaurant businesses are not yet seeing positive YoY card sales, this quarters 4.1 percent rate of decline is the smallest decrease reported since Q2 2008. </p>

<p>Dr. Larry Ponemon of the Ponemon Institute, states We recently conducted a Small Business Data Theft Risk Management study  and the results were very telling. In summary, it indicated that over 20% of small businesses had already suffered a data breach. A general conclusion from the study was that small businesses do not have adequate measures or remedies in place to protect themselves. Small businesses generally lack the resources and expertise to fend off attacks as compared to larger firms. Additionally, an SMB having an attack or negligent error will experience problems that could prove catastrophic.</p>
<p>&#13;</p>
<p>Every business has significant and real exposures to business identity fraud and separately, to data breach incidents involving customer information, trade secrets or other data assets. Although each involves a breach to data, to clarify the difference, a data breach is typically defined as the loss or theft of sensitive customer information, like an individuals name plus their Social Security Number (SSN), drivers license number, medical record or financial record/credit/debit card, which exposes the information to unauthorized use/fraud. <p>When data loss occurs, incident response obligations and liabilities arise as influenced by data breach notification laws in 46 states. There is little doubt, data theft risks and costs are significant, in part influenced by the type of data lost and the interruption to operations. Global Payments recently suffered a loss of 1.5 million payment cards, but the breach as reported did not include social security numbers.  While large data breaches receive the media attention, breaches at small businesses tend to fly under the radar. A report by VISA indicates that 80% of all card breaches arise from Level 4 merchants (small businesses).  </p>
<p>&#13;</p>
<p>In contrast to the breach of sensitive customer or employee data, is the theft of business identifying information or BII. Business identity fraud occurs when a thief writes a fraudulent check, steals a business license, bank account, merchant account, EIN, web site and/or other BII and uses the information fraudulently for abuse or gain. While the much publicized consumer identity theft remains an epidemic affecting roughly 10 million individuals each year as highlighted in reports by Javelin Strategy &amp; Research, business identity fraud presents a much newer and devastating scourge. Indeed, the typical risks and severity of loss are much greater for a business than for an individual. <p> eScholar LLC, a leader in driving the application of research and data to personalize education, today announced an industry first with eScholar Interstate ID eXchange.  Used at the State Education Agency level, eScholar Interstate ID eXchange allows staff to find and correctly identify students that travel between participating states, provides unduplicated identification and maintains aliases of participating states.  Currently being implemented with four State Education Agencies, including Kansas, Iowa, Missouri and Nebraska, Interstate ID eXchange promotes improved communication and accelerated exchange of information, while helping identify false dropouts.</p>
<p>&#13;</p>
<p>Currently, State Education Agencies need to identify, share, or verify data on students that have relocated outside of state lines, especially those students who have relocated without notifying their district.  Once a student is reported as a dropout, it is a challenge for the district and State Education Agency to identify the student as a false dropout without a direct connection to the relocation state.  &#13;<br />
